The idea was that if a variable is used more than once in a formula,
it was assumed to be the same variable (ie. T-TD/T). So, if you
had the variable in the formula 10 times, you didn't have to
select it 10 times. In the meantime, you could...
(There may be better ways to accomplish this problem, Don, but the main
thing (right now) is just to make you aware of this problem...)....
....create a formula (D1+D2) (or TA1 + TA2 - anything to make
them different) and it should allow you choose arbitrary
values. This way you could create an arbitrary formula
for addition and then select whatever you want to add.
Having the variable names does not give you automatic
selection in the datatree anyway, so using generic names
is just as well.
